Valletta Green Festival 2021 opens The Valletta Green Festival – the annual event which is synonymous with the Maltese Cultural Calendar – has opened.
Valletta Green Festival 2021 opens The Valletta Green Festival – the annual event which is synonymous with the Maltese Cultural Calendar – has opened.